The C1D1 modular booth is engineered for optimal safety and efficiency in environments where volatile compounds are present. Designed to meet stringent Class 1 Division 1 (C1D1) standards, this extraction booth provides a secure and controlled space for operators to handle hazardous materials safely. Every booth is certified by a professional engineer and comes with the documentation needed for permitting in any city or state. While we serve any hazardous industry, we are proud to be the longest standing booth manufacturer in the extraction industry and have a patent surrounding plant extraction safety.
